摘要
Ab initio calculations have been used to locate optimal structures for the ground states of N2, tetrahedral N4, and the probable transition state for the dissociation of N4 to two N2 using a variety of basis sets and Møller-Plesset perturbation theory through fourth order. The energy of formation of N4 from two N2 is calculated to be 814 kJ/mol, and the barrier for the dissociation of N4 through a transition state of D2d symmetry is found to be 315 kJ/mol. © 1990 American Chemical Society.
